All of the Hunter subclasses are getting something neat. Arcstriders will get some defensive utility with their altered super and new attunements. And though I personally think it’s a bit counterintuitive, Gunslingers now have some crowd clearing options if for whatever reason their team is lacking it with their new super. It’s the Nightstalker though that is getting the flashiest changes out of all of them though.

The Nightstalker’s new super pretty much brings back the Bladedancer from Destiny 1, but in a crazy, souped-up form. The Nightstalker can go invisible, gain true sight (aka see where enemies are) smash enemies in the face with katanas, and then return to stealth. While yes, giving up the bow is going to be hard to do, especially in PvE, I can see this being incredibly powerful in PvP and Trials of the Nine. The Nightstalker also gets a new altered smoke grenade that can slow enemies that get caught in its path down, and through the use of a new attunement will go invisible after every precision kill.

I’d be interested to see how raiders make use of the heavy focus on invisibility, but even if the bow still is the most popular option in PvE, PvP is definitely going to be shaken up by this new path.
